Pioneer introduces next generation of network connected receivers

avic-f960dab_blue_left Pioneer Europe announces the release of five in-car receivers, combining on-board avic-f960dab_white_leftfeatures with connected services and controlled using a rich and powerful new user interface. The five new models, four navigation and one audio video receiver, are designed especially for today’s smartphone-driven lifestyle. Along with network connectivity and an enhanced UI, the new models also come equipped with large touchscreen displays with the flagship AVIC‑F60DAB featuring the industry’s first 7-inch capacitive screen on a navigation system. Benefits and features in the line-up include AppRadio Mode, AVICSYNC Networked Navigation, MirrorLink compatibility, Siri Eyes Free mode, expanded Bluetooth1 capabilities, Aha Radio support, FLAC file playback, dual camera input and more.

“We are proud to introduce our next generation of network connected in-dash receivers, bridging the gap between smartphone related products like our AppRadio and traditional multimedia products like navigation and DVD receivers,” said Philippe Weyers, Marketing Communications Manager CE at Pioneer Europe. “By leveraging the connectivity of the smartphone, we are able to augment and update many of the built-in features with dynamic cloud based content.”

avic-f960dab_red_front_topThe new range includes the AVIC‑F60DAB, the AVIC-F960BT, the AVIC-F960DAB and the AVIC-F860BT navigation receivers, and the AVH-X8600BT AV receiver.

Pioneer’s AppRadio Mode provides both iPhone and Android users the ability to access and control dozens of apps directly from the large touchscreen display of the AVIC‑F60DAB, the AVIC-F960BT, the AVIC-F960DAB and the AVH-X8600BT when connected to iPhone 4 or iPhone 4S, iPhone 5, or a compatible Android smartphone.
